IO Interactive Confirms 007 First Light Will Run at 60fps on PS5 Pro

After months of concerns regarding 007 First Light’s performance, IO Interactive has confirmed the upcoming Bond game will run at 60fps. When 007 First Light’s gameplay was revealed in September 2025, fans grew concerned about the game’s performance. The frame rate appeared to be pretty choppy, particularly during big, busy action sequences.

IO Interactive seems to have used its extra time on First Light’s development to smooth out performance issues, and has confirmed that the game will run at 60fps on the PS5 Pro and will hit 60fps in performance mode on base PS5. 007 First Light will also have a quality mode, which will allow the game to have higher fidelity, but run at 30fps.

IOI hasn’t addressed performance on Xbox Series X, but it will presumably offer similar performance and quality modes as the base PS5 version. The Xbox Series S version is a bit more questionable. Due to its weaker hardware, the Xbox Series S doesn’t typically have the same variety of graphics options, so it’s hard to say just how the new Bond game will run.

Regardless of performance, 007 First Light has a lot of hype behind it. We gave the game a glowing preview earlier this month, and despite the expected success of the game, IO Interactive has claimed it won’t abandon its roots in the Hitman franchise in favor of 007.

007 First Light releases on May 27, 2026, for Xbox Series X|S, PS5, and PC.
